Rear Camera and Flash Not Working

Hello everyone! I turned my iPhone 6S on today and went to go take a picture, but the back camera was completely black and it would freeze the phone for a bit and then I could change it to the front facing camera. On top of that the flash on the back does not turn on when I activate it through control center. The oddest part is that if I open any app that uses the rear facing camera (Facebook, Snapchat, etc.) the back flash, flashes a couple times like an odd peachy color and then turns off. It managed to go through one time, but what I ended up seeing was a pink and white hued screen which would bleed out and go back to normal. Have yet to be able to make this happen again. Help would be appreciated! I'm hoping it's something software related because I don't really want to have to break into the phone seeing as I'm not too great at that.

The first and easiest thing to try is a hard reset. Hold down the Home and Power Button for 10 secs until you see the Apple logo. I doubt that will fix it but it's simple enough that you shouldn't exclude it.

If you still have same problem, then the next step is to open it up. If you're uncomforatble with this, then I highly recommend you take it to a reputable shop in your area. It could just be a defective camera. This could have happened shortly after a drop (or more than a few).

If you do want to take a look, follow this guide. I would go through it completely before trying the repair. You can buy a replacement camera here.
